Border Patrol Agents Find Previously Deported Migrants Crammed In Back of Vehicle
April 30, 2021 ADI Staff Reporter
Agents arrested 5 migrants after stopping a vehicle near Wellton. Two suspected smugglers were also taken into custody. [Photo courtesy U.S. Customs and Border Patrol]

YUMA – On Thursday morning, Border Patrol agents foiled a migrant smuggling attempt after conducting a traffic stop.

Yuma Sector agents working highway operations east of Wellton, conducted a vehicle stop on a Ford Edge on the eastbound lanes of Interstate 8 at mile marker 80 at approximately 7:30 a.m. Agents discovered 5 migrants in the vehicle, three of which were previously removed from the United States and could face re-entry charges.

The two suspected smugglers, a 36-year-old male driver and a 19-year-old male passenger, both U.S. citizens out of Palmdale, California.
